发明名称 TRAINING CONVOLUTIONAL NEURAL NETWORKS ON GRAPHICS PROCESSING UNITS
摘要 <p>A convolutional neural network is implemented on a graphics processing unit. The network is then trained through a series of forward and backward passes, with convolutional kernels and bias matrices modified on each backward pass according to a gradient of an error function. The implementation takes advantage of parallel processing capabilities of pixel shader units on a GPU, and utilizes a set of start-to-finish formulas to program the computations on the pixel shaders. Input and output to the program is done through textures, and a multi-pass summation process is used when sums are needed across pixel shader unit registers.</p>
申请公布号 IL189124(D0) 申请公布日期 2008.08.07
申请号 IL20080189124 申请日期 2008.01.30
申请人 MICROSOFT CORPORATION 发明人
分类号 G06F 主分类号 G06F
代理机构 代理人
主权项
地址